The rise of fast cycle game design

One of the defining characteristics of modern Roblox mini games is their short development and iteration cycle. Developers are able to create a concept, launch it, and refine it based on feedback in a matter of days or weeks.

This speed creates a dynamic environment where trends can emerge rapidly. A simple mechanic, if engaging enough, can spread across the platform and inspire variations from other creators. Players are not just consumers in this process. They actively influence how these games evolve.

Because of this, success is often tied to accessibility. The easier it is for a player to understand what to do within the first few minutes, the more likely the game is to gain traction.

Community driven progression systems

Unlike traditional games with structured progression paths, many Roblox mini games rely on loosely defined systems that evolve alongside the community. Progression may come in the form of collectibles, upgrades, or unique items that players can obtain through gameplay.

What makes these systems interesting is how they are shaped by player behavior. Developers observe what players engage with the most and adjust the experience accordingly. This creates a feedback loop where progression feels organic rather than fixed.

The role of humor and randomness

Another key factor behind the popularity of these mini games is their embrace of humor and unpredictability. Many viral experiences are built around chaotic or unexpected outcomes that create memorable moments.

This randomness serves two purposes. It keeps gameplay fresh, and it makes content more shareable. Clips of unusual or funny events are more likely to spread across platforms, bringing new players into the experience.

Rather than focusing on balance in the traditional sense, these games often prioritize entertainment value. The goal is not necessarily to create a perfectly competitive environment, but to keep players engaged through constant variation.

Social interaction as the main driver

At their core, these games thrive on social interaction. Whether players are competing, cooperating, or simply exploring together, the presence of others enhances the experience.

Roblox provides a unique environment where social features are deeply integrated into gameplay. Players can easily join friends, communicate, and share their experiences. This connectivity amplifies the reach of viral mini games, as players invite others to join and participate.

The social aspect also influences how players perceive value within the game. Items, achievements, and progression milestones often carry meaning because they can be seen and recognized by others.

Why simplicity continues to win

Despite the platform’s ability to support complex projects, many of the most successful games remain relatively simple in design. This simplicity allows developers to focus on core ideas that resonate with a wide audience.

A straightforward concept can be more effective than a complicated system if it captures attention quickly. Players are more likely to return to a game that offers immediate enjoyment rather than one that requires a long learning curve.

This does not mean these games lack depth. Instead, their depth emerges over time through player interaction and community driven updates.
